(KNSI) —The St. Cloud Fire Department says no one was hurt, but a camper suffered major damage Sunday night.
According to a critical incident report, the call came in about 10:20 for a camper fire in the driveway of a home in the 1400 block of 3rd Street North. Firefighters said when they arrived, the camper was fully involved. They put it out, and no damage to any other vehicles or buildings was reported. Damage is estimated at $3,000.
The cause of the fire is under investigation by the St. Cloud Fire Department and the Fire Marshal’s office.
